WebJan 24, 2024 · How to turn on colors for ls command. Use any one of the following command: $ ls --color=auto. $ ls --color=tty. Define bash shell aliases if you want: alias ls='ls --color=auto'. You can add or remove ls command alias to the ~/.bash_profile or ~/.bashrc file. Edit file using a text editor such as vi command: $ vi ~/.bashrc.
